Does Teeth Whitening Work?

Many people wonder, "Does teeth whitening work?" The answer is a resounding, "Yes!" Teeth whitening definitely does work. Thousands of people have had their teeth successfully whitened. But how does teeth whitening work?

Teeth whitening, or bleaching, works by penetrating the tooth enamel with a special peroxide-based bleaching gel containing either hydrogen peroxide or carbamide peroxide.

The special gel actually removes stains and debris that accumulate over the years within the layers of the teeth.

Teeth do tend to darken over the years as well as become more difficult to whiten. This is due to various factors such as dietary habits, whether or not you smoke, your dental hygiene, and genetic factors.

The sooner you begin regular whitening, the easier it will be to get a really white smile.

Professional Teeth Whitening

The advantages of professional, in-office, teeth whitening are clear. The benefits are twofold: Because professional gels are stronger than gels made for home use, you will get more dramatic results faster. Period.

The most effective teeth whitening gels get their power from peroxide. Both professional and home use gels have peroxide, but home whitening products usually contain carbamide peroxide while professional gels contain hydrogen peroxide.

Hydrogen peroxide gels are at least three times stronger than carbamide peroxide: the bleaching power of 24% carbamide peroxide gel is equivalent to 8% hydrogen peroxide gel.

To make the case for professional teeth whitening even stronger, carbamide peroxide must break down into hydrogen peroxide before it will start bleaching the stains in your teeth. It takes awhile for it to break down, so it takes a lot more time and treatments to whiten your teeth. That's why most home teeth whitening products say to use the gel once or twice a day for a week or more. Compare that to three or fewer professional strength treatments done over the course of an hour or less.
